Footnote: in September 1989 I interviewed Matt Groening in his office on the Fox lot. He had just seen the first episode of the Simpsons back from the animators and was in deep despair because it was awful, so we didn't talk about the Simpsons. Mostly we discussed Life in Hell, and Thomas Pynchon.

Back in August several academics raised concerns that a Deloitte report to government may have been generated using AI. Deloitte denied this and put the citation errors down to poor editing.

Anyway, Deloitte are refunding the government $440,000 for a report that was written using AI.
